17. Research & Development Activities
1.Market and technology research
2.MDeC or MOSTI Funding
3.Center of Excellence – example Adempiere ERP
4.Sirim Certification to ensure OS quality

18. Community Building Activities
1. OSDC.my Open Source Conference
2. Participation in International Open Source Conference
3. LinuxVarsiti joint participation in Institutes of Higher
Learning events
4. OSDC.my Developer CD and Book publications
5. OSDC.my Tuition for W3Schools Certification
6. OSDC.my Malaysian developer community awards
7. OSDC.my OSS Workshop and Training
8. Collaboration with MDEC OSS Industry Certification
9. Penguin Masuk Kampung Program
10.Participation in Google Summer of Code

20. University Activities
1. OSDC.my LinuxVarsiti joint participation in
Institutes of Higher Learning events
2. Working with University Students Council to
establish Open Source Club
3. Membership drive campaign for graduates.
